The video tutorial discusses the sublease consent form in the context of sublease agreements. It highlights the distinction between a sublease and an assignment, noting that a sublease involves a tenant and a subtenant, typically covering part or the entirety of the premises. In a sublease, the tenant transfers only their privity of estate, maintaining a separate contractual relationship with both the subtenant and the landlord. This means the subtenant does not have a direct contractual relationship with the landlord. If issues arise with the premises, the tenant must communicate these to the landlord. If the lease does not restrict subleasing rights, tenants may generally sublease freely, but should seek consent to prevent misunderstandings.
